Does anyone know when they removed the LED from the stop/start switch? My 2020 Laramie had the LED but my 2021 Limited doesn't have it.

Found this on another forum, hope it helps someone.

"Yes the programming change was applied to this issue. My light NOW illuminates. Description from my receipt listed below:

"3827 service bulletin 18-048-21 18-19-06-EB Module, Powertrain Control (PCM) Reprogram current part number 68502742AC to targeted part number 68502742AD"

Old post I know... but funny, my '19 Bighorn doesn't have Auto Stop/Start. Sits there and idles in traffic and no button to disable it. Only thing I can figure is it may have been an early build, so it wasn't included?

I just saw a interior shot of my '22 Tradesman I got on order, and there is the button... I wish Ram offered the A.S.S. delete option on their trucks from the factory like Ford does..

The stop/start comes on engines that have etorque, which I'm assuming your 19 didn't have. And apparently your new ram does have it, as otherwise you can still opt for the standard non etorque hemi without the stop/start.
